Trump publicly criticizes Israel on Truth Social for attacking Iranian gas field, threatens US escalation
President Trump issued a strongly-worded Truth Social post criticizing Israel for its attack on Iran's South Pars gas field, stating the US 'knew nothing' of the strike. Trump said Israel had 'violently lashed out' at the major facility 'out of anger for what has taken place in the Middle East.' He declared that 'NO MORE ATTACKS WILL BE MADE BY ISRAEL' on the field unless Iran attacks Qatar again, while threatening that the US would 'massively blow up' the Iranian facility if such attacks occurred. The public rebuke of a key ally and threat of US military escalation marked a significant moment in Middle East tensions. The incident followed Iranian strikes on Gulf energy sites in Qatar, though the timeline and sequence of escalations remain unclear from available reporting.
